Markdown,作为一种轻量级的标记语言,以其简洁的语法和易于使用的特点,在撰写和发布格式化的文本内容方面受到了广泛的欢迎。以下是对Markdown语法的详细解析,旨在帮助您更好地理解和运用这一工具。
基本语法
标题
在Markdown中,标题的创建是通过在文本前添加不同数量的 # 符号来实现的。# 的数量决定了标题的层级:
#表示一级标题##表示二级标题###表示三级标题- 依此类推…
例如:
# 这是一级标题
## 这是二级标题
### 这是三级标题
段落
Markdown会自动将连续的文本行视为一个段落。要创建新的段落,只需在行首行尾各留一个空行即可。
空行
在两个段落之间添加至少一个空行,可以在文档中创建一个明显的分节。
换行
在文本中按下 Shift + Enter 键,可以在不创建新段落的情况下创建一个换行。
引用
在文本行首添加一个或多个空格,然后跟一个 > 符号,可以创建一个引用。根据 > 的数量,可以设置引用的对齐方式:
- 一个
>:左对齐 - 两个
>:居中对齐 - 三个
>:右对齐
例如:
> 这是一个左对齐的引用
>> 这是一个居中对齐的引用
>>> 这是一个右对齐的引用
分隔线
使用三个或以上短横线 ---、星号 *** 或下划线 ___ 作为分隔线,可以在文档中创建分隔线。
强调
斜体
使用单个 * 或 _ 包裹文本,可以将其转换为斜体。
粗体
使用两个 * 或 _ 包裹文本,可以将其转换为粗体。
粗斜体
使用三个 * 或 _ 包裹文本,可以将其转换为粗斜体。
删除线
使用两个波浪线 ~~ 包裹文本,可以为其添加删除线。
链接
在Markdown中创建链接非常简单,只需使用方括号包裹链接文本,圆括号包裹链接地址:
[链接文本](链接地址)
如果要为链接添加标题,可以使用以下格式:
[链接文本](链接地址 "链接标题")
图片
图片的插入同样简单,使用方括号包裹图片文本,圆括号包裹图片地址:

列表
无序列表
无序列表通过在列表项前添加 *、+ 或 - 来创建:
* 列表项1
* 列表项2
* 列表项3
有序列表
有序列表通过在列表项前添加数字和英文句点来创建:
1. 列表项1
2. 列表项2
3. 列表项3
表格
Markdown中的表格可以通过以下格式创建:
| 表头1 | 表头2 | 表头3 |
| --- | --- | --- |
| 内容1 | 内容2 | 内容3 |
| 内容4 | 内容5 | 内容6 |
代码
行内代码
使用反引号 包裹代码片段,可以创建行内代码:
`这是一个行内代码片段`
代码块
使用三个或以上反引号包裹多行代码,可以创建代码块:
这是一个代码块
表情
Markdown支持插入表情,只需使用冒号加各种表情符号即可:
:smile:
HTML
Markdown支持直接使用HTML标签,这使得在Markdown文档中嵌入HTML内容变得简单。
总结
Markdown的语法简洁明了,能够帮助用户快速创建格式化的文本内容。通过以上解析,相信您已经对Markdown有了更深入的了解。现在,不妨动手尝试,用Markdown记录您的想法,分享您的知识吧!
